Woman Power SBS Downtown Lecture Series

“Join us this October for the eighth Annual Downtown series. This year’s series explores the themes of fairy tales, gender-based violence, Latinas in politics, African American women’s language. The final event is an interview with special guest Yalitza Aparicio, the first Indigenous woman nominated for an Academy Award for Best Actress for her role in the 2018 Mexican drama Roma.
